Rating:  Summary: Simply one of the best Review: Achtemeier's commentary on Romans is simply the best commentary on the market for the layperson. Commentaries written by academics are often not useful to the general public, since they use Greek or Hebrew and assume a great deal about the reader's background. On the other hand, most of the popular commentaries are simply too shallow. Achtemeier does an excellent job of clarifying the issues for the average reader. If you can only buy one commmentary on Romans, this should be your choice.
Rating:  Summary: A very readable commentary. Review: I really enjoyed this commentary. This was my first experience with the Interpreation commentaries and I was impressed. Dr. Achtemeier did an excellent job of writing for the lay person as well as the full-time minister. It was very readable, which is, unfortunately, kind of rare in Bible commentaries.
